France, Brazil Forge Military Pact

By NATHALIE SCHUCK
Associated Press Writer

SAINT-GEORGES DE L'OYAPOCK, French Guiana - France is ready to transfer technology to Brazil so that an attack submarine, helicopters and the Rafale fighter plane can be built there, French President Nicolas Sarkozy said Tuesday.

Sarkozy met with his Brazilian counterpart, Luiz Inacio Lula da Silva, in Saint-Georges de Oyapock, on the border with Brazil on the second and last day of his trip to France's largest overseas territory.

Sarkozy also said France was willing to transfer technology to allow a French attack submarine and fighter planes to be built in Brazil, but he stopped short of any nuclear technology transfer.
(snip)

The Scorpene class submarine is a conventional attack submarine, but Brazilian officials have said they want the diesel-powered sub to serve as a model for the development of a Brazilian nuclear submarine that would be the first in Latin America.
